Brazilian carrot cake

Brazilian carrot cake

Dessert · world favourite.

120 min1200 kcalserves 4

Ingredients

Method

  1. Heat the pan — Heat the oven to 180C/160C fan/ gas 4. Oil and line the base of a 20cm springform cake tin.
  2. Mix together — Mix the flour, sugar and baking powder together in a large bowl and set aside.
  3. Blend — Tip the oil, carrots and eggs in a blender and blitz until smooth.
  4. Stir — Pour the wet ingredients into the dry, stirring until smooth.
  5. Continue cooking — Pour the batter into the cake tin and give it a shake to get rid of air bubbles.
  6. Bake — Bake for 45 mins to 1 hr, until a clean knife or skewer inserted into the middle comes out clean.
  7. Continue cooking — If the middle is sticky, put back in the oven for a further 5 mins.
  8. Continue cooking — Remove from the oven and leave to cool in the tin.
  9. Heat the pan — For the drizzle, heat the milk, cocoa and sugar in a saucepan over a low heat.
  10. Stir — Stir until the sugar dissolves (about 5 mins), creating a thick, shiny drizzle.
  11. Continue cooking — Remove the cake from the tin and level the top using a serrated knife, then flip so the bottom becomes the top.
  12. Continue cooking — Pierce all over using a knife or toothpick and put on a wire rack with a tray or large bowl underneath.
